**Action Item PM-2471-03:** Upgrade the Quillbrook message broker from 4.2 to 5.1 before the next release window. The 4.2 line lacks per-queue flow control, which contributed to the backlog cascade during the outage. Owner: platform team; target: end of sprint 14. Release manager should hold the train until the upgrade soaks in staging for 48 hours. Upgrade runbook and rollback steps are documented on the internal page.

runbook for tafof-yawif: https://confluence.tolvaqsys.internal/display/display/browse/pages/7be3

Minutes — Management Meeting, Halverton Office

Attendees: R. Mosk, T. Abrell, sales leads.

The licensing dispute with Cordwain Digital over the Brayfield module was reviewed. Cordwain claims our Pellet Suite bundle exceeds seat entitlements; our counsel disagrees. Sales leads must pause new Brayfield quotes pending resolution, expected within six weeks. Renewals proceed as normal. T. Abrell will circulate talking points for customer questions. The confidential business plan affected by this dispute is noted below.

internal memo for hafog-hadug: The pricing group signed off on a budget of $16.1 million for Project Gorir. The renewal with Oliionax Systems closes at $14.1 million a year, 46 percent above the last contract.

**Q: Why do invoices render with blank line items in PaperQuill?**

Usually a stale template cache. Run the flush script in the renderer repo, then re-queue the invoice. If totals are wrong, that's upstream in Ledgerbird, not PaperQuill. Check the render logs before filing a ticket. Still stuck? Send details to the renderer team.

pager mailbox: fenael_wenael@norvalabs.corp